Santiago de Compostela is world-famous as the final destination of the Camino de Santiago (Way of Saint James), a pilgrimage route that has attracted travelers and pilgrims from across Europe since the Middle Ages.

At the heart of the city stands the magnificent Cathedral of Santiago de Compostela, traditionally associated with the shrine of Saint James the Great. In 1985, the historic center of Santiago was decl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site because of its exceptional cultural and architectural importance.
